On Tue, Sep 20, 2005 at 08:55:47AM +1000, Nigel Cunningham wrote:
> I got on the same page eventually :). When you have it ready, I'll be
> happy to try it. Apart from trying another 75 suspends (which I'm happy
> to do), I'm not really sure how we can be totally sure that the patch
> fixes it. Do you have any thoughts in this regard?

Since this seems to be related to CPU down event, you could run a
tight loop like this overnight (for all CPUs in the system):

	while :
	do
		echo 0 > online
		echo 1 > online
	done


This, maybe in conjunction with some other test like LTP or make -jN bzImage,
is usually enough to capture all CPU-hotplug related problems.
